Make sure that you make a contribution from every one of your paychecks to your 401(k) plan. If your employer matches your contributions, pay as much as you can into it. A 401k permits savings of pre-tax funds, thus allowing you to accumulate more money. If you work for someone who matches each contribution you make, that’s pretty much free money in your pocket.

Are you overwhelmed and thinking about why you haven’t started to save? Don’t give up. It’s better to start now than not at all. Check your finances and decide how much you can afford to save each month. Don’t fret if it is not a lot. Saving anything is better than saving nothing.

You should take a close look at any retirement plans that you participate in with the company you work for. If they have something like a 401k plan, try signing up and contributing what you can. Learn everything there is to know about the plan, and don’t withdraw the money until you’re able to do so without penalty.

How should you invest? You must make sure that your portfolio is well-diversified so that you don’t run into trouble from making only one type of investment. It will make your savings safer. Consider waiting a few extra years to take advantage of Social Security income if you can afford to. Waiting will boost your eventual monthly take, helping ensure financial security later on. This is easier if you can continue to work, or draw from other income sources.

Downsize your lifestyle to save money during retirement. While you may believe that you have a good handle on your financial future, unexpected events often occur. Medical bills and things like big house fix expenses can really hit you hard during your life, and they are really hard to deal with when you retire.

The belief is, once you retire, you’ll have the free time to do all the things you’ve dreamed about your entire life. Time can get away from us very quickly, however. Planning your daily activities in advance can make sure you are organized and properly utilize your time.

Set goals for both the short and long term. This will help you to maximize your savings. If you need to know how much cash you need to know how much to save. By just doing a bit of math, you can figure out how much you need to save every week and every month.

Retirement might be the best time in your life. Sometimes a lifelong hobby can be profitable, and many people are successful when they can work at home. This is a pretty low-stress time of your life to do it since you don’t have to worry about how you’re going to pay everyday expenses.

As you near retirement, start paying off your loans. You will have an easier time with your car and house payments if you get them paid in large measure before you truly retire. Lowering your debt load will make it easier to retire.
